GOD WITH US: TO BRING REDEMPTION…

Jesus had to come to be with us so He could be both human and GOD to us. He understands temptation even better tahn we do because He has stood up to it eery time! Never once in His 33 years on earth did He give in to sin in throught, word or deed. In the end, He took on our sin and paid for it by dying and He gave us His perfect record of a sinless life. Our redemption is not based on our work, but on His. Not on our record, but on His. As a result, we can stand before GOD with a perfet record, but with nothing to brag about because we didn't do it!
